“Me Before You” is a contemporary romance novel written by Jojo Moyes, published in 2012. The narrative follows Louisa Clark, a cheerful and quirky young woman who finds herself in a difficult financial situation. She takes on a job as a caregiver for Will Traynor, a man who is paralyzed from the neck down after a tragic accident. The story is set in a small town in England and unfolds as Louisa and Will develop a complex relationship that challenges their perspectives on life.

Plot Summary

The plot centers on Louisa's efforts to improve Will's quality of life, which is filled with despair and hopelessness due to his condition. Despite their differences, they embark on a journey that leads to transformative experiences for both characters. The story highlights themes of love, sacrifice, and the importance of living life to its fullest.

Genre and Audience

“Me Before You” falls under the genre of contemporary romance and has attracted a wide audience, particularly young adults and women. The emotional depth of the characters and the societal issues presented resonate with readers, making it a compelling read.

2. Characters: A Closer Look

The characters in “Me Before You” are intricately developed, each playing a crucial role in the narrative. Below, we delve into the main characters and their significance.

Louisa Clark

  • Personality: Louisa is portrayed as cheerful, quirky, and somewhat naive. Her resilience and determination to make Will's life better form the crux of her character.
  • Development: Throughout the story, Louisa undergoes significant personal growth, discovering her own desires and ambitions.

Will Traynor

  • Background: Will is a former businessman who led an adventurous life until his accident changed everything.
  • Transformation: His relationship with Louisa helps him confront his feelings about life and his condition, leading to critical decisions by the end of the story.

Supporting Characters

  • Patricia Traynor: Will's mother, who struggles with her son's condition and the choices he makes.
  • Treena Clark: Louisa’s sister, who provides insight into Louisa's family dynamics and personal challenges.

3. Themes Explored in the Story

“Me Before You” addresses several poignant themes, which are crucial to understanding the narrative's impact.

The Value of Life

The story poignantly explores what it means to live a fulfilling life. Will’s perspective on life as a quadriplegic challenges readers to think about quality versus quantity of life.

Love and Sacrifice

The evolving relationship between Louisa and Will encapsulates the essence of love, highlighting how genuine affection can lead to selflessness and sacrifice.

Choices and Consequences

The novel raises questions about the choices we make and their consequences. Will’s decision at the end of the story serves as a catalyst for discussions about euthanasia and the right to choose one's fate.

4. Impact and Reception

Since its publication, “Me Before You” has sparked numerous discussions and debates, particularly surrounding its themes of disability and assisted dying.

Critical Reception

The book received mixed reviews from critics, with some praising its emotional depth while others criticized its portrayal of disability. However, it became a bestseller, resonating with many readers worldwide.

Cultural Impact

The story’s exploration of life choices has prompted discussions about disability rights, assisted dying, and the societal perceptions of people with disabilities, making it a significant cultural touchstone.

5. Biographical Insights: Jojo Moyes

Jojo Moyes is a British author known for her engaging storytelling and rich character development. Born in 1969, Moyes has written numerous bestsellers, with “Me Before You” being one of her most acclaimed works.

Personal InformationDetails
NameJojo Moyes
Birth DateAugust 4, 1969
OccupationAuthor
Notable WorksMe Before You, The Giver of Stars, One Plus One

6. Adaptation: From Page to Screen

In 2016, “Me Before You” was adapted into a film starring Emilia Clarke and Sam Claflin. The film closely follows the book's plot and has been praised for its performances and emotional depth.

Film Reception

The film received generally positive reviews, with many viewers moved by the performances and the story, although it also reignited debates about its themes.

Differences Between Book and Film

While the film stays true to the book, certain elements and character backgrounds are streamlined for cinematic purposes, which may alter the depth of certain themes.
